I am setting up a monthly cost per tb memory and storage in Aria Operations. They like to change the location in every version of aria operations, the following is to setup a price card and assign it to a resource. I am using it as a monthly on-going cost for memory and storage in my lab.
First thing is to change your cost/price currency to Australian or whatever your currency is used in your country
Login to aria operations > expand administration > click global settings > click cost/price > click currency settings and change (you cant change this once done so don’t mess up)

Next enable vc pricing in your policy and enter your pricing.
Expand operations > click configurations > click policy definitions > select your default policy or create a new one > select vc pricing > use the unlock button to enable pricing engine > unlock the basic charges too and put in your info and whatever else you need to add


Now we will apply that pricing policy on an object
Click home > click launchpad > click cost > click view on pricing policy assignment

Find your object on the right and drag it to the left, I put in vcenter and my cluster



Now go to your object you should have some costing associated now
